I live in the Los Trancos Woods area—do auto transport trucks have trouble navigating those narrow, winding roads?
Yes, many carriers prefer avoiding the tight turns and overhanging trees common in Los Trancos Woods and similar Portola Valley neighborhoods. We recommend scheduling a pickup or delivery at a designated meeting point on Alpine Road or near the Portola Valley Town Center, where larger equipment trucks can maneuver safely.
Does the frequent coastal fog in Portola Valley affect auto transport scheduling or vehicle condition?
Fog is common from late spring through early fall, especially near the Windy Hill Open Space Preserve. While it doesn't typically cause delays, we advise customers to choose enclosed transport for high-value vehicles to protect against moisture and road debris. Our drivers are familiar with the microclimate and plan routes accordingly.
